Job summary

ERM is seeking a Principal Technical Consultant, Archaeologist to lead cultural resource strategy and delivery across the Great Basin from Idaho. The role is remote, full-time, with a strong emphasis on technical leadership, client engagement, and business development across the United States.

You will oversee archaeologists, manage complex studies, ensure compliance, and collaborate with multidisciplinary teams to expand ERM’s market presence in cultural resources consulting.

Qualifications

  • Graduate degree in Anthropology, Archaeology, or a closely related field of study, or equivalent experience.
  • 6-8 years of related paid experience.
  • Secretary of the Interior-qualified archaeologist listed as a Registered Professional Archaeologist (RPA), with qualifications meeting or exceeding SHPO requirements within the Great Basin.
  • Demonstrated field experience and principal-level oversight of projects throughout the Great Basin, including inventory, survey, testing, and data recovery efforts.
  • Experience serving as a primary author and/or third-party reviewer of agency-reviewed technical reports, including: Class I and Class III technical reports; NEPA documentation; Cultural Resources Treatment Plans; Other regulatory documentation.
  • Experience interacting directly with regulatory agencies while representing client interests.
  • Ability to travel occasionally to project locations throughout the Great Basin region.
  • Experience using mapping and field technologies, including GPS equipment, total stations, ArcGIS Field Maps, Survey123, and related applications.

Responsibilities

  • Provide strategic cultural resource leadership across Great Basin projects.
  • Maintain and expand regulatory permitting capabilities.
  • Lead project execution and technical review efforts.
  • Mentor, supervise, and develop cultural resources staff.
  • Support business development and client growth initiatives.
  • Drive collaboration across ERM’s multidisciplinary service offerings.
  • Manage project quality, budgets, schedules, and client expectations.
  • Represent ERM as a trusted technical expert and principal investigator.
